Image copyright University of Tokyo Image caption The Poimo has been designed to fit inside a rucksackAn inflatable e-scooter compact enough to be stored inside a commuter's backpack has been unveiled in Japan.
The Poimo, developed by the University of Tokyo, can be inflated in just over a minute, using an electric pump.
The creators said they wanted to create a vehicle that minimised the potential for injury in the event of an accident.
However, experts say e-scooter rules still need to be clarified by the government before such modes of transport can be considered safe.
